The TW9930-LC1-GR is a high-performance analog video decoder with integrated analog pre-filter and built-in auto brightness control (ABC). This Intersil device is designed to decode standard analog baseband television signals such as NTSC, PAL, and SECAM and convert them to digital YCbCr or RGB formats. It features robust performance and a wide range of functionalities ideal for demanding video applications.
Applications
- Automotive display systems
- Rear-view camera systems
- In-car entertainment systems
- Surveillance equipment
- Portable video players
Features
- Multi-standard analog video decoding (NTSC, PAL, SECAM)
- Integrated analog pre-filter
- Built-in auto brightness control (ABC)
- Automatic gain control (AGC)
- Automatic clamp control
- 10-bit ADC resolution
- YCbCr and RGB output formats
- I2C interface for control and configuration

Additional Details
The TW9930-LC1-GR is designed for low power consumption, making it suitable for portable and automotive applications. The integrated pre-filter helps to reduce noise and interference in the analog video signal, leading to a cleaner and more accurate digital output. The auto brightness control (ABC) function automatically adjusts the brightness of the video output based on the ambient light level, improving visibility in different lighting conditions. The device is available in a compact package. The 10-bit ADC ensures high precision in the analog-to-digital conversion process, resulting in high-fidelity video reproduction.
